Frequently Asked Questions
Is 180gr JHP a good weight for .40 S&W carry? Yes, 180 grains is the standard defensive weight for .40 S&W, balancing expansion, penetration depth, and manageable recoil.
Can I train with the same load I carry? Yes, this JHP is priced closely enough to FMJ practice ammo that many shooters train and carry the identical load for consistent point of impact.
